Crawford and Sebastian counties could lose almost $600 million in Medicaid funding over a decade if proposed federal legislation is approved, according to “rough” estimates from the Arkansas Advocates for Children and Families.

The Fort Smith Board of Directors has asked city staff to better communicate sewer system work to address improvements mandated by a federal consent decree. Part of that communication will begin Tuesday (June 23) at the board’s study session. The board also is set to hear a presentation about “advanced metering infrastructure” that could help the city reduce an estimated 35% “non revenue water loss” from billing errors and other factors.

The hiring of Wes Milam as director of public safety communications for the City of Fort Smith is a key step in the consolidation of 911 operations in the city and Sebastian County into a center expected to be fully operational by 2027. Milam for more than two decades has been employed by the Fort Smith Police Department (FSPD), most recently as a department captain. His first day on the 911 job is June 23, according to the City of Fort Smith press release.
